A few of the most famous modern paintings are associated with an age referred to as surrealism. Emerging throughout the nineteen-twenties, surrealism has actually retrospectively been seen as a creative response to the absurdity of the First World War. With its emphasis on dreams and the subconscious, surrealist painters aimed to augment reality into a" surrealiy' through their art. Surrealism as a concept also impacted other art mediums such as literature and cinema.
When discussing influential modern art movements, cubism is a design that often features. Exactly why is this the case? Well, cubism belonged to an eruption throughout the visual arts. A few of the greatest modern paintings of all time are related to this influential technique to art. Essentially, cubism shifted how we see viewpoint. Cubism included the presentation of a number of viewpoints concurrently. The principal objects or topics in cubist art are as a result in some cases quite puzzling to fathom, relatively buried amidst fragmented perspectives. A few of the most famous paintings of all time are referred to as works of impressionism. What was impressionism and what were some of its key attributes? Impressionism was an art motion that occurred throughout the second half of the nineteenth century. Despite the fact that impressionist art is nowadays connected with some of the most beautiful paintings of all time, at the time it was thought about to be a threat to the status quo of conventional art. Encountering this brand-new approach to art, one critic dismissed the style as simple 'impressions', paradoxically producing the name for among the most iconic art movements while doing so. In terms of visual design, integral to impressionism was a sense of obscurity; brusher strokes became thicker, colours more awash instead of defined. On an official level, this was among the most iconoclastic aspects of impressionism: it interfered with the hitherto obedient relationship in between form and representation. Maybe the more subjective component to impressionism was a reaction to the introduction of a more industrialised but fragmented contemporary world. Indeed, depictions of modernity can be seen in numerous impressionist canvases. When examining art history, what we can note is that impressionism marked a turning point; it can be seen as a shift far from classical art worths, where experimentalism began to take precedence to official representation. The artwork of impressionist artists continued to influence subsequent art motions, such as post-impressionism and cubism.
